What types of engineers work in labs?

Engineers working in labs include mechanical, electrical, civil, chemical, and software engineers, each specializing in different technical fields. They often use tools like CAD software, testing equipment, and simulation programs to design, test, and improve products or systems in a controlled environment.

What is the difference between Engineering Design Lab vs Mechanical Engineer?

AspectEngineering Design Lab

Engineering Design Lab roles focus on hands-on product development, prototyping, and experimental testing within a lab environment. They often require skills in CAD, prototyping, and basic engineering principles, with certifications like engineering degrees or technical diplomas. Mechanical Engineers also work in labs but typically have broader responsibilities including design, analysis, and manufacturing processes. Both roles are common in industries like aerospace, automotive, and manufacturing, but Engineering Design Labs emphasize experimental work and rapid prototyping, while Mechanical Engineers focus on comprehensive design and analysis.

What is a design engineer's job salary?

A design engineer's salary varies based on experience, location, and industry, but typically ranges from $65,000 to $110,000 annually. Entry-level positions may start lower, while experienced engineers with specialized skills or certifications can earn higher wages, especially in high-demand sectors like aerospace or automotive design.

THE ROLE:

As an Advanced GPU HW Hardware Development Lab Engineer, you will be chiefly responsible for managing GPU server platforms in the validation test datacenter lab.  This will include responsibilities such as setting up lab infrastructure, lab networking, lab systems, SW tools, test automation support, HW test equipment, running HW validation tests and debugging system level issues.  While working with cutting edge HPC (high performance computing) technologies, you will be part of a team enabling the bring-up and development of advanced GPU systems and designs.  This Lab Technician is part of a cross-functional technical team working with Sr. Validation and Design engineers, other lab personnel and the Facilities team.

THE PERSON:

A successful candidate must be curious, self-driven, collaborative, and a strong team player with hands-on technical experience and skills to support datacenter labs test operations.
Must be proactive, innovative and have excellent teamwork, communication and organization skills, and be effective at multi-tasking.

Proven experience in Server systems bring-up, HW validation, automation, and debug in a server datacenter environment 

Candidate should understand the general silicon engineering process (preferably GPU, or CPU/APU), from concept to tape-out to production.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ES:

Test System Configuration and Maintenance

    • Key points of contact for setting up and maintaining validation test systems; including
    • Configure and deploy GPU prototype systems set ups
    • Resolving associated issues with the HW validation test equipment
    • Lead & drive lab activities and assigned programs pertaining to equipment readiness and co-ordination for pre and post-silicon validation efforts of NPI products
    • Assist in various lab-related requirements including equipment ordering, facilities coordination, equipment management, maintenance, repair to meet product schedules

System testing

    • Server System setup responsibility; including OS, automation infrastructure, SW/driver images, diagnostics/tools, etc.
    • Test equipment setup responsibility - including using scopes, thermal chambers, debug headers, etc.
    • Board and system-level debug

General

    • Analyze and report any issues or concerns
    • Close issues in collaboration with other cross-functional engineering teams
    • Develop lab-related tests, debug improvements, and efficiencies for better overall test execution and throughput capacity
    • Soldering, reworking HW

PREFERRED EXPERIENCE:

  • Hands-on experience working in a Hardware Development Datacenter Labs
  • Knowledge of computer hardware architecture (CPU/APU, graphic cards, memory, bus logic, and display technologies) and software architecture (driver/bios)
  • Experience with test equipment - scopes, thermal chambers, etc.
  • Solid understanding of circuits/board design, schematics
  • Fluent in various Software operating systems including Linux, Windows, MAC
  • Hands-on debug experience with GPU/APU, motherboards, memory interface, bus logic
  • Scripting knowledge includes Perl, Ruby, Python, Bash, etc.
  • Ability to set up hardware and build computer systems
  • Experience working with cross functional teams
  • Excellent organizational and communication skills

ACADEMIC CREDENTIALS:

  • Bachelor’s (BS) or master’s (MS) Degree in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, Computer Science or other relevant discipline.
